The Chief Minister's Office of Odisha announced on Tuesday, 7 July 2026 that comprehensive administrative arrangements have been put in place for the world-famous Rath Yatra of Mahaprabhu Shri Jagannath, describing the festival as the supreme symbol of Odia identity. The state government outlined measures spanning security, health, sanitation, traffic control, and special train services to serve the lakhs of devotees expected to converge on Shrikhetra.

Context

The Rath Yatra at Puri is one of the world's largest religious processions, drawing millions of pilgrims annually to pull the chariots of Lord Jagannath, Balabhadra, and Subhadra along the Grand Road (Bada Danda). Puri, known traditionally as Shrikhetra, is one of India's four sacred dhams and the spiritual heartland of Odisha. The festival's scale makes it one of the most logistically demanding public events the state administration manages each year.

The CMO's post, written in Odia, stated that 'extensive arrangements have been made by the administration for the smooth conduct of the world-famous Rath Yatra of Mahaprabhu Shri Jagannath, the greatest symbol of Odia identity.' It added that the state government's 'foremost resolve is to make this sacred union of devotee and God safe, orderly and flawless, and to provide every pilgrim a pleasant spiritual experience.'

Policy Backdrop

The Government of Odisha has a long-standing practice of deploying multi-department operations for the Rath Yatra, treating it simultaneously as a cultural heritage event and a large-scale public-safety exercise. Arrangements typically involve coordination between the state police, health department, municipal bodies, and railway authorities. The deployment of special trains is a recurring feature, easing pressure on road transport and enabling pilgrims from across India to reach Puri with greater convenience.

Sanitation and medical cover have in recent years been prioritised alongside crowd management, reflecting a broader pattern seen across Indian states that host major religious gatherings. The explicit mention of traffic control signals heightened attention to movement management within and around the Jagannath Temple precinct during peak congregation hours.
